Innovations in Production Technologies

One of the most remarkable innovations in sand making technology is the integration of AI and machine learning algorithms. These technologies enable real-time monitoring and adjustments, significantly improving the operational efficiency of sand production lines. Zenith’s latest VSI (Vertical Shaft Impactor) crushers are equipped with intelligent control systems that automatically regulate the feed rate, rotor speed, and crushing chamber geometry to maximize output and product quality.

Another noteworthy development is the introduction of high-strength, wear-resistant materials in the construction of sand making equipment. Zenith’s new range of sand mills and crushers utilize advanced alloys and ceramics that drastically reduce maintenance requirements and extend the service life of the machinery.
